Purpose of License Law / Rules and Regulations - ANSWERS-Do everything necessary to enforce Alabama license law -Adopt and enforce rules and regulations How many Real Estate commissioners? - ANSWERS(9) 7 commissioners from each of the 7 congressional districts, the black member and the consumer commissioner Qualifications for 7 Commissioners and black commissioner? - ANSWERS-AL resident for 10 years -Employed as RE sales people/brokers for 10 years -Not eligible if convicted of violating any federal/state RE license law Qualifications for consumer commissioner? - ANSWERS-21 y/o -AL resident for 10 years -Registered voter in AL -No felony convictions -Must be owner of real property -Has NOT been licensed sales person/broker during previous 10 years -Is NOT related to/employed by a RE licensee Who is AL license law written by? - ANSWERSAL State Legislators Who wrote the Rules & Regulations? - ANSWERSAL RE Commissioners How does one become a RE Commissioner? - ANSWERS-APPOINTED by the governor -CONFIRMED by the senate How many terms does a commissioner serve? - ANSWERS-5 year terms -Cannot serve more than 2 consecutive terms Quorum - ANSWERS-5 Commissioners -Must be present to conduct business When is a new chairperson elected? - ANSWERSEvery time a commissioner is added Who do the Commissioners employ? - ANSWERS-An executive director -An assistant executive director -Other staff if necessary What are commissioners paid? - ANSWERS-$300/month -Travel expenses -A per diem Is a commissioner liable when performing duties? - ANSWERSNo commissioner shall be liable for damages resulting from any act performed in carrying out duties as a commissioner When is a license required? - ANSWERS-Sell, exchange, purchase, rent or lease RE belonging to someone other than the owner him/herself, or his/her spouse, child or parent -Negotiate for any of above functions -List or offer to list real property for any of above functions -Auction real property -Buy, sell or deal in options on RE -Aid in locating or obtaining RE for above functions -Procure prospects for effecting the sale, exchange, lease or rental of RE Procure properties for effecting the sale, exchange, lease or rental of RE -Present oneself as being able to perform an act for which a license is required When is one exempt from needing a RE license? - ANSWERS-Owner dealing with their own property or property of spouse, child or parent -Attorney, when performing professional duties for a client -A person acting w/o compensation under a duly authorized power of attorney -A person/state/financial institution acting as a receiver, trustee, administrator, executor, or guardian; or acting under a court order, trust instrument in will -Public officer performing their official duties -Person is performing clerical or administrative duties for a licensee -Manager of an apartment complex -Person licensed to sell timeshares -Person selling cemetery lots Qualifications for an Original License? - ANSWERS-Trustworthy/competent so as to safeguard the interests of the public -Cannot have had a RE license rejected or revoked in any state during the previous 2 years for any reason except failure to pass state exam -19 y/o+ -US citizen/legally present w/appropriate documentation/alien w/permanent resident status -High school graduate or equivalent -Complete 60 hour course within 1 year from date of enrollment (including passing course exam w/70%+) -Pass AL State exam w/70%+ AL Reciprocal License - ANSWERS-Complete 6 hour reciprocal salesperson/broker course -Pass AL reciprocal state salesperson/broker exam w/70%+ (40 multiple choice on AL license law) -Show proof of current license in other state Post-License Education - ANSWERS-A temporary salesperson's license is only valid for 1 year -Must be turned into an original license within 1 year by taking 30 hour post license course Broker License Requirements - ANSWERS-Have had a salesperson's license for 24 of the last 36 months -60 hour broker course -Pass course final & state exam Qualifying Broker - ANSWERS-Person under whom the company is licensed -Supervising broker responsible for acts of company & licensees -Licensed in AL -Principal business must be that of a QB -Must be in a position to to supervise activities of licensees working for them on a full-time basis Associate Broker - ANSWERS-Any broker other than a qualifying broker -Not responsible for supervising/managing licensees Termination of QB status - ANSWERSCompany withdraws from broker/licensee -Notify commissioner in writing -Notify broker/salesperson in writing -Return license QB withdraws from company -Give written notice to the company -Give written notice to the commission Temporary QB - ANSWERSIf a QB dies/becomes disabled, company license would become inactive -HOWEVER, company has 30 days to designate a temporary QB -Must be a broker or salesperson w/at least 1 year experience -Company has 6 months to designate the real QB
